Svein Haugsgjerd
Svein Haugsgjerd (born August 3, 1942) is a Norwegian psychiatrist and psychoanalyst. He is notable for using psychodynamic psychotherapy to treat patients with schizophrenia.He is influenced by the Kleinian tradition in psychoanalysis and by the French psychoanalyst Jacques Lacan, on whom Haugsgjerd wrote a book-length introduction in 1986.
He has published extensively on the field of psychodynamic psychiatry in Norwegian. Several of his books, including textbooks, have been translated into other Nordic languages. Provided by Wikipedia
